Those are all great possibilities, and worth examining on each job. BUT the offending TX-NR series receivers I have installed all seem to have the same exact issue.
Lets say it is poor power grounding... on so many jobs? I usually follow behind the cable company and check for proper ground. I place the network equipment on battery back up and or surge depending on the rack.
If it were a power tolerance issue, would that be because of cheaply protected circuits in the HDMI circuitry?

I have since moved on to Maraantz and really like their product much better. If there are issues I will only use Zektor switches instead of a receiver altogether.-- It is possible to designate their audio outputs as L/C/R RR/LR.
